The Spanish monastery was originally erected in Segovia, Spain. A few hundred years later, newspaper magnate William Randolph Hearst bought it and separated it and brought it back to the United States piece by piece. In 1954, the Spanish monastery re-established its current location. It is often used as a venue for weddings, movies and advertisements. It is a very popular tourist attraction.
